Marks and Spencer, or M&S is a British multinational retailer that sells clothing, food cosmetics furniture, as well as home appliances. It has more than 703 stores in the United Kingdom and abroad, and employs more than 138,000 employees worldwide. The company's headquarters are in London, England. The website has a wide range of products, including shoes and clothing for women and men. Customers can browse through the product catalogue or look up specific items. The site is simple to navigate and provides a variety of payment options including PayPal.

The company was founded in 1884 when Jewish refugee Michael Marks opened a stall in an open market in Leeds. The stall's sign read "Don't ask the price - it's just a penny". When the business became successful, Marks decided to seek a partner and invited Thomas Spencer to join him. Spencer invested 300 pounds and brought considerable expertise in management and accounting, complementing Marks' flair for sales and merchandise.

The early stores of M&S were conceived to cater to changing social requirements. Marks adapted to the changing social conditions by using open displays, encouraging browsing and self selection. At this point the company's growth was rapid. In 1915, it had 145 stores.

In the 1960s, M&S started to develop its own brand of products. This included the introductions of synthetic fibres like Tricell and Coutelle and knitwear that was machine washable. In the 1980s, lingerie was given an edge in fashion with coordinated sets that were based on catwalk fashions.

M&S is committed to lessening its impact on the environment. It has formulated an eco-plan of 100 points that impacts every aspect of the business, from heating in the store to product labelling. The goal is to cut down on emissions, promoting healthy food and establishing fair partnerships and using sustainable raw materials.

Founded in 1947, Hennes & Mauritz AB is the second-largest fashion retailer in the world. Its success is built on speedy fashion. This means identifying trends and bringing low-cost copies of the latest trends to stores as quickly as it is possible. Unlike other retailers, which may take months to design and create new styles, H&M can create a new collection in only two weeks. This is the reason H&M stores are always filled with new clothes.
